What is Automation?

At its core, automation is the use of technology to perform tasks that would otherwise be done by humans. This can take many different forms, from robots assembling cars on a factory floor to software programs that automate repetitive administrative tasks in an office environment. The key to automation is that it reduces the need for human intervention, allowing businesses to operate more efficiently and at a lower cost.

How Does Automation Work?

Automation relies on a variety of technologies, including robotics, artificial intelligence, and machine learning. In many cases, automation is made possible by advances in sensors and other technologies that allow machines to sense and respond to their environment. For example, a robot on a factory floor might use sensors to detect the presence of a part and then use a robotic arm to pick it up and assemble it with other parts.

In other cases, automation relies on software programs that can analyze data and make decisions based on that data. For example, an accounting program might automatically reconcile bank statements with a company’s accounting records, flagging any discrepancies for further review by a human accountant.

Impact of Automation on Society

While automation has many benefits for businesses, it also has significant impacts on society as a whole. One of the most significant impacts is on employment. As machines become more capable of performing tasks that were previously done by humans, there is a risk that many jobs will be automated out of existence. This can lead to higher levels of unemployment and greater income inequality.

At the same time, automation can also create new jobs in industries that rely on automation technology. For example, robotics technicians and engineers are in high demand as businesses look to implement more automation in their operations. However, these new jobs often require more specialized skills and training, leaving many workers who have been displaced by automation struggling to find new employment.

Another impact of automation is on productivity. By reducing the need for human labor, automation allows businesses to produce more goods and services at a lower cost. This can lead to greater efficiency and lower prices for consumers, but it can also contribute to overproduction and environmental damage.
